Before the unified "System Platform" approach became standard, Wonderware released the InTouch 10.x series. InTouch 105 typically refers to version 10.5 of the standalone HMI software. It bridged the gap between the classic Windows XP-era interfaces (v9.5) and the more modern, .NET-influenced designs of later versions. Given the age of v10
